Output 6639f51e5a7b21adaf5f0dc0a43429e4949ae09a92bf33aa5734dd259d6cd94a:24

value
3586
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 300bc68f4124685a61790ad621a784ca7cad9f161e79bd6b545779850ffd24af
address
bc1pxq9udr6py3595ctepttzrfuyef72m8ckreum66652auc2rlayjhs9mjd72
transaction
6639f51e5a7b21adaf5f0dc0a43429e4949ae09a92bf33aa5734dd259d6cd94a
spent
true